| 18-11 | 7 | | Lotto Zesdaagse Vlaanderen-Gent (1) | |
| 29-06 | 67 | | National Road Championships - Spain (CN) | 200.0km |
| 27-06 | 18 | | National Road Championships - Spain TT (CN) | 47.0km |
| | | Tour of Estonia (2.1) |
| 30-05 | DNF | | Stage 1Tallinn - Tartu | 190.0km |
| | | Szlakiem Grodòw Piastowskich (2.1) |
| 25 | | Standings |
| 11-05 | 18 | 25 | Stage 3Polkowice - Polkowice | 30.0km |
| 10-05 | 91 | 49 | Stage 2Zlotoryja - Polkowice | 161.0km |
| 09-05 | 52 | 27 | Stage 1Swidnica - Dzierzoniow | 156.0km |
| 21-04 | 70 | | Rund um Köln (1.1) | 192.0km |
| 02-03 | 1 | | UCI Cycling World Championships - Track (Madison) (CM) | |
| 27-02 | 10 | | UCI Cycling World Championships - Track (Individual Pursuit) (CM) | |
| 26-02 | 5 | | UCI Cycling World Championships - Track (Team Pursuit) (CM) | |
| 11-02 | 132 | | Trofeo Deià (1.1) | 152.0km |
| 10-02 | 93 | | Trofeo Migjorn (1.1) | 183.0km |
| 09-02 | 137 | | Trofeo Palma (1.1) | 116.0km |